Learning Objectives

Ability to recognize, describe and interpret the tectonic structures of the crust both at the meso- and
microscale and at the regional scale.
Ability to recognize and describe the deformation mechanisms of rocks and to interpret large regional
tectonic structures, both in a convergent, divergent and transcurrent settings.

Detailed Course Content

Basics of rock mechanics, rheology and rock deformation mechanisms. Structural analysis and
interpretation of major geological structures.
Stress and strain in two and three dimensions. Planar and linear structures. Folds. Shear areas, faults and
fractures. Extensional tectonics. Salt tectonics. Transcurrent tectonics. Fold and thrust belts. Relations
between deformation and metamorphism. Use of stereographic projections in structural analysis.
Recognition of brittle and ductile deformation structures on the ground.
